Whitchurch is a small town of around 7,198 people, eight miles east of Andover and twelve west of Basingstoke. It became a borough in 1284 and had a royal charter by 1285, holding a Monday market as Witcherche by 1241.
The centre carries the constraints that come with that age: frontages onto the road, limited parking, and older property with tighter stairs and doorways built well before modern furniture. Where we cannot get a van close, the job becomes a carry.
The town sits on the River Test, which still powers the Whitchurch Silk Mill where cloth is woven to this day. Properties on the low ground near the water are worth flagging when you book, because access there can change with conditions.
The A34 runs north to south just west of the town and the A303 is four miles south, so the run in is easy. The railway arrived in 1854 on the Basingstoke to Salisbury line, and the roads around the station are busiest at the ends of the day.
